Coronado's charm is largely due to it's location and all that it offers in a relatively small area of space. You can drive to it from the San Diego-Coronado Bridge, but if you have the time and want to take in the gorgeous scenery, take the ferry from Broadway Pier instead.
The San Diego Film Festival's goal is to bring much-due attention and positivity to the art of independent film making. The individuals who produce, direct, and star in the featured movies get their time and attention in the spotlight, as a plethora of parties, workshops and special events are always on the itinerary. This glamorous and glitzy event is held every year in the Gaslamp Quarter.
